The Myth of God Defeating the Leviathan

If the Leviathan were a dinosaur, I don't know what's so evil about any of the dinosaurs and why God would want to slay one in that way. It just doesn't make a lot of sense to me. Plus, the Psalms, I think it's the Psalms described. Leviathan is having more than one head, multiple heads. Not one of them is known to have multiple heads. Sounds more like the dragon in Revelation 13, which is again a symbol of evil,. but God's going to slay all the birds is what he's really getting.I feel like that's just pushing the Bible too far to try and make these animals a dinosaur.
